Title: Bees in the polytunnel
Post by: lewic on June 30, 2010, 13:53:41
I am getting loads of bees in my polytunnel, which is great for pollination but they seem to spend most of their time trapped in the corners, trying to get out. Sometimes I find them crawling around in my picnic stuff, presumably having exhausted themselves.

Does anyone know how I coax them away from the roof and down to my plants, or out of the door? I have tried wafting them out with a fly swat but this only seems to annoy them!
Title: Re: Bees in the polytunnel
Post by: kt. on June 30, 2010, 16:39:07
Tie some brightly coloured luminous ribbon to the window opening where you want them to exit.  (Yellow, red)
